Description

Gemini 3.8 Flash Cyber represents Google's most advanced cybersecurity model, offering top-tier performance in identifying vulnerabilities and automating patching processes with remarkable speed for rapid iteration. Tailored for trusted defenders, it is accessible via the Fairwind Program. On CyberGym, a recognized industry benchmark for detecting vulnerabilities, this model showcases exceptional autonomous vulnerability discovery, outperforming both Gemini 3.5 Flash Cyber and larger frontier models. Furthermore, Google assessed its effectiveness on an internal benchmark that spans complex codebases across 20 programming languages, achieving a success rate of over 70% in identifying various vulnerabilities. Unlike many models that focus on offensive strategies, Gemini 3.8 Flash Cyber emphasizes the importance of fixing vulnerabilities, providing defenders with advanced tools that enhance their ability to stay ahead of cyber attackers. This focus on proactive defense represents a crucial shift in the cybersecurity landscape, prioritizing the safeguarding of systems over mere exploitation capabilities.

Description

Qwen3.8-Flash-Next represents an open-weight multimodal Mixture-of-Experts architecture and serves as an initial glimpse into the design intended for Qwen4. This model strategically enhances attention mechanisms, residual pathways, embeddings, and optimization techniques to boost its capabilities, improve computational efficiency, expand model capacity, and ensure training stability. Its innovative hybrid architecture merges Gated DeltaNet, which adeptly compresses past information, with Qwen Sparse Attention, enabling the selection of significant context at a micro-block level to lessen both attention and indexing costs associated with lengthy sequences. The Gated Residual feature broadens the residual pathway into four streams, dynamically managing the flow of information across different layers. Additionally, the N-gram Embedding integrates large-scale local-pattern memory with minimal added computation per token, and it can be transferred to host memory for further efficiency. The model is structured around a 125B-parameter main network supplemented by 51B parameters dedicated to N-gram embeddings, activating only 6B parameters for each token processed. This sophisticated framework highlights the ongoing advancements in machine learning architectures, setting a promising stage for future developments.
